Lemon Tek is one of the most popular methods for consuming mushrooms. It increases trip intensity, leads to a much quicker onset, and results in a slightly shorter overall duration. The acid in the lemon juice converts non-active psilocybin into active psilocin, essentially pre-digesting it so it can be absorbed faster by the stomach.

Instructions

  1. 1.

    Prepare the Mushrooms

    Hands using a chef's knife to finely chop dried magic mushrooms on a wooden cutting board, with a bowl of whole mushrooms nearby.
    Before you start, decide on the dosage you want to take. You can use any amount for Lemon Tek, just adjust the lemon juice accordingly. Use our Magic Mushroom Calculator to find the perfect dosage for you!

    It doesn’t matter if you use fresh or dried mushrooms. Just keep in mind that you might need more lemon juice for fresh ones due to their higher volume. Cut them into small pieces or grind them into a powder. The finer, the better, because breaking up the cell walls significantly increases extraction efficiency, ensuring you get the most out of your mushrooms.

    The finer, the better, as this allows the lemon juice to access the active components more effectively. You can use a knife, a blender, a coffee grinder, or a mortar and pestle.
  2. 2.

    Add Lemon Juice

    Hands squeezing fresh lemon juice from a lemon half into a glass containing chopped dried magic mushrooms for Lemon Tek preparation.
    Next, add the lemon juice. It doesn’t matter if it’s fresh or bottled. Stir the mixture and make sure everything is completely submerged. You can basically use any acidic liquid with a pH between 2-3. Lemon juice is optimal because it also contains Vitamin C, which protects the psilocin from oxidation and degradation. More details here.
    💡
    You can also use lime juice, orange juice, or even apple cider vinegar.
  3. 3.

    Let It Sit for 15–20 Minutes

    Chopped magic mushrooms submerged in lemon juice soaking in a clear glass on a wooden countertop, with a lemon half sitting beside it.
    This is enough time for the acid in the lemon juice to break down (pre-digest) the fungal material. Most of the active components will be transferred into the lemon juice during this time. The acid converts psilocybin (non-active) into psilocin (active), a process that usually happens in the stomach. Since it is essentially "pre-digested," it can be absorbed immediately once ingested.
  4. 4.

    Strain Out Mushroom Pieces (Optional)

    Pouring the magic mushroom and lemon juice mixture through a fine mesh sieve into a clean glass to filter out the solid mushroom pieces.
    Now, you can strain out the remaining mushroom pieces. While not mandatory, this is the best option for most people to avoid the bad taste and potential nausea caused by eating the fungal solids. You won’t miss out on potency, as most of it is now in the liquid. If you do decide to eat the pieces, the lemon juice will have broken down their structure, making digestion easier, though this doesn't guarantee zero nausea.
  5. 5.

    Add Water and Enjoy!

    Pouring water into the concentrated lemon tek liquid to dilute the acidity, with a jar of honey nearby for sweetening.
    Pure lemon juice is very sour, so it’s a good idea to dilute it with some water, though this isn't strictly necessary. While the sour taste remains intense, adding water helps significantly. If you like, you can add a sweetener like honey to improve the flavor. However, from experience, it’s best to just down it all at once without thinking too much about the taste.

Frequently Asked Questions

Lemon Tek is a popular method of consuming magic mushrooms that involves soaking chopped fungi in lemon juice for about 20 minutes before ingestion. The citric acid mimics the stomach's natural acids, converting psilocybin into psilocin externally. This process typically leads to a faster onset, a more intense experience, and reduced nausea compared to eating dried mushrooms raw.

A Lemon Tek trip generally lasts between 4 to 6 hours. Because the body absorbs the pre-digested psilocin rapidly, the total duration is shorter than eating raw mushrooms (which can last 6 to 8 hours). However, users often report that the peak effects are stronger and set in much faster, usually within 15 to 30 minutes.

Yes, you can use fresh mushrooms for Lemon Tek, though dried mushrooms are more common. If using fresh ones, it is crucial to chop them as finely as possible to increase the surface area. Since fresh mushrooms contain a lot of water and have more volume, you will need to use a larger amount of lemon juice to ensure the material is completely submerged.

Lime juice works perfectly as it has a pH level (2.0–2.8) almost identical to lemons, making it ideal for the conversion process. Orange juice is not optimal due to its higher pH (around 3.5–4.0), but it still works. However, the reaction will be slower, so if you choose orange juice, you should let the mixture steep for an extra 10–15 minutes.

Lemon Tek is not meant to be stored and should be consumed immediately, ideally within 20 to 30 minutes after preparation. Once psilocybin is converted into psilocin, it becomes unstable and oxidizes rapidly when exposed to air (turning the liquid blue or black). Storing it for later use will result in a significant loss of potency.
